The Northern Arizona Lumberjacks (10-21) are headed to Idaho Central Arena on Saturday where they will attempt to defeat the Idaho State Bengals (12-19) in the Big Sky Championship.

The Northern Arizona Lumberjacks faced Montana State and took a loss by a score of 76-65 in their last game. In the matter of personal fouls, the Lumberjacks walked away with 12 while Montana State accumulated 14 personal fouls. They also knocked down 12 out of their 31 tries from beyond the arc. Montana State finished the contest at 61.5% from the free throw line by making 8 of their 13 tries. On top of that, Montana State snagged 29 rebounds (5 offensive, 24 defensive), but wasn't able to put a block in the stat sheet. Montana State earned 10 dimes and had 5 steals for the matchup. With respect to defending, Northern Arizona allowed their opponent to shoot 50.9% from the field on 28 of 55 shooting. They also dished out 13 dimes in this contest while forcing the opposition into 7 turnovers and having 5 steals. Pertaining to hauling in rebounds, they earned 28 with 8 of them being offensive. From the charity stripe, the Lumberjacks made 6 of 8 tries for a rate of 75.0%. Northern Arizona finished the game having earned a 44.8% field goal percentage (26 out of 58) and made 7 of their 21 3-point shots.
Oakland Fort is a guy who came through in the matchup. He finished shooting 83.3% from the field and also recorded 4 assists. He was on the court for 34 mins and also collected 3 rebounds. He finished with 26 points on 10 out of 12 shooting.

Northern Arizona will take the court with a win-loss mark of 10-21 on the year. They are turning it over 10.5 times per contest and as a team they are committing 17.3 fouls every game. As a unit, Northern Arizona is pulling in 29.9 rebounds per game and has tallied 408 dimes this season, which ranks 228th in the country in terms of passing the ball. The Lumberjacks are hitting 37.2% on shots beyond the perimeter (235 of 631) and 68.0% from the free throw line. They currently have an average of 71.5 points per outing (281st in college hoops) while connecting on 46.6% from the field.

On the defensive end, the Lumberjacks are able to force 11.7 turnovers every game and they draw 16.4 personal fouls. They concede 38.2% from 3-point land and they are 250th in Division 1 in PPG from their opponents (76.5). The Lumberjacks are giving up a FG percentage of 48.4% (851 of 1,757) and they surrender 34.8 rebounds per game as a team. They are 225th in college in allowing assists to the opposition with 424 conceded so far this season.
When they last stepped on the hardwood, the Idaho State Bengals took a loss by a score of 83-65 when they faced Sacramento State. The Bengals earned 19 defensive boards and 9 offensive boards for a total of 28 for the matchup. They turned the ball over 12 times, while getting 5 steals for this contest. Sacramento State committed 19 personal fouls in this contest which took the Bengals to the charity stripe for 21 tries. They were able to knock down 15 of the free throw attempts for a percentage of 71.4%. Regarding shots from distance, Idaho State made 6 of 29 tries (20.7%). When the game finished, the Bengals went 22 out of 58 from the field which had them shooting 37.9%. The Bengals allowed Sacramento State to make 29 of their 54 attempts from the field which left them with a rate of 53.7% for the contest. They wrapped up this game 38.9% from downtown by hitting 7 of 18 and walked away from this one shooting 18 out of 23 from the free throw line (78.3%). Concerning rebounds, Idaho State allowed Sacramento State to grab 33 overall (4 on the offensive glass).
Louis Bond was important for the Bengals in the game. He racked up 15 points in his 24 minutes on the hardwood and had 1 assist in the matchup. He converted 6 of 10 for the contest for a field goal rate of 60.0%, and added 5 rebounds.
Idaho State has a mark of 12-19 this season. When it comes to offense, the Bengals are shooting 45.3% from the field, which ranks them 177th in college. Idaho State has totaled 2,308 pts on the season (74.5 per contest) and they pull in 32.8 rebounds per contest. They are assisting teammates 12.0 times per contest (321st in college) and they are turning it over 11.1 times per contest. The Bengals have committed 17.2 personal fouls every game and they shoot 75.0% from the free throw line.
The Idaho State defense surrenders 35.8% on shots from 3-point land (236 of 659) and opponents are connecting on 76.9% of their free throw attempts. They give up 12.9 assists and 29.4 rebounds every game, which is 139th and 9th in D-1. The Bengals on the defensive side of the court are 243rd in Division 1 in points allowed per game with 76.2. They are able to force 10.2 TO's per game and allow teams to shoot 47.6% from the floor (339th in D-1).
